Transaction ddaf845523868f6c9758f875837c84dd37fab73070f978cd04be87bd60d76053
1 Input
1 Output
-
ddaf845523868f6c9758f875837c84dd37fab73070f978cd04be87bd60d76053:0
- value
- 38922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5f1b9726260cfaa3275d95e0ee7346badd52dc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DyntSkZT9oGGhpuU1Qd39Lb9aifA579Az